Job Title: Trusts and Estates Associate Attorney

Job Overview:
A well-established law firm in New York City is seeking an experienced Trusts and Estates Associate Attorney to join its dynamic team. This is an excellent opportunity for a skilled attorney to work closely with senior attorneys in providing comprehensive legal services to high-net-worth individuals, families, and businesses. The role involves estate planning, trust administration, and probate, with a focus on drafting legal documents, advising clients, and navigating complex estate issues. The position offers a hybrid remote work opportunity, with periodic travel to the Bantam office for those based in Connecticut.

Duties:

  • Provide legal counsel in estate planning, trust administration, and probate matters for high-net-worth clients.
  • Draft, review, and finalize key estate planning documents such as wills, trusts, powers of attorney, and advance healthcare directives.
  • Offer strategic advice to clients on ways to minimize estate taxes and protect assets.
  • Assist in the administration of estates and trusts, including filing legal documents, managing asset distribution, and resolving disputes.
  • Stay updated on developments in estate planning, tax law, and probate law through legal research.
  • Work collaboratively with clients' financial advisors and accountants to design comprehensive estate plans.
  • Represent clients in probate and trust administration court proceedings when necessary.
  • Build and maintain strong client relationships through effective communication and understanding of client needs.

Requirements:

  • 4-6+ years of experience in trusts and estates law.
  • Admission to the New York Bar (Connecticut and/or Massachusetts Bar is a plus; the ability to waive is also acceptable).
  • Juris Doctorate from an ABA-accredited law school and membership in good standing with the bar.
  • Proven experience in drafting estate planning documents, including complex trusts and estate administration.
  • Experience with estate, gift, and fiduciary income tax returns.
  • Demonstrated ability to represent fiduciaries and beneficiaries in Probate Court matters.
  • Strong writing and verbal communication skills.
  • Exceptional organizational skills and ability to prioritize multiple tasks.
  • Ability to adapt to new information quickly and manage competing priorities effectively.
  • Strong sense of responsibility, dedication, and professional conduct.
  • Ability to work well with diverse personalities and within various levels of an organization.
